Career Counselor jobs in Gwinnett, Georgia involve providing guidance and support to individuals seeking career direction. Counselors assess skills, interests, and goals to help clients make informed decisions. They offer advice on resume writing, job search strategies, and interview preparation. These professionals play a vital role in assisting individuals in achieving their career aspirations. Below you can find different Career Counselor positions in Gwinnett, Georgia.

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Career Counselors in Gwinnett, Georgia provide individuals with guidance and support to help them navigate their career paths. - Entry-level Career Counselor salaries range from $35,000 to $45,000 per year - Mid-career Career Advisor salaries range from $45,000 to $60,000 per year - Senior-level Career Consultant salaries range from $60,000 to $85,000 per year The history of Career Counselors in Gwinnett, Georgia dates back to the early 20th century when vocational guidance services began to emerge in response to the industrial revolution and the need for skilled workers in specific fields. As the field of career counseling evolved, professionals in Gwinnett, Georgia began to focus on a holistic approach, taking into account an individual's interests, values, and skills to help them make informed career decisions. Current trends in career counseling in Gwinnett, Georgia include the integration of technology tools for career assessments, the emphasis on work-life balance, and the recognition of the importance of continuous learning and professional development. Career Counselors in Gwinnett, Georgia play a crucial role in helping individuals explore career options, set goals, and develop strategies to achieve success in their chosen fields.
